Due to continued growth, we are seeking a highly motivated individual to fill an open role in our Oak Creek, WI location.   As a Fire Protection Suppression Manager, you will thoroughly understand, support and expand our Fire Suppression business by providing exceptional customer service for existing and potential new customers, and lead training and development efforts for your team.

Job Responsibilities:

  • Foster growth by understanding and implementing strategies within our existing business and through extended offerings.
  • Develop team by providing and tracking technical training and keeping all up to date on NFPA codes
  • Support and promote our safety policies and practices.
  • Ensure all company, customer and project policies, procedures, standards, licenses/certifications, etc., are adhered to.
  • Maintain effective relationships with existing customers.
  • Actively seek new relationships and opportunities by working with our sales team.
  • Estimate, propose, and execute service/inspection opportunities.
  • Understand technical aspects of fire suppression practices and equipment, and ensure inspections and work are being performed at the highest level of quality. 
  • Manage extinguisher shop and equipment and field leaders. 
  • Understand and take responsibility for contract management to ensure a successful outcome for customers and the company.
  • Be a “Team Player” that is willing to help anyone who may need assistance.
  • Be “hands-on” with inspection or repairs if required.
